Subject: [PATCH 09/10] mpt3sas: Adding support for SAS3616 HBA device
Date: Tue, 10 Oct 2017 18:41:22 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1507641083-20207-10-git-send-email-Sreekanth.Reddy@broadcom.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1507641083-20207-1-git-send-email-Sreekanth.Reddy@broadcom.com>

Adding PNP ID of Mercator i.e. SAS3616 HBA device.
Its device ID is 0xD1 and vendor ID is 0x1000.

Signed-off-by: Sreekanth Reddy <Sreekanth.Reddy@broadcom.com>
---
 drivers/scsi/mpt3sas/mpt3sas_scsih.c | 5 +++++
 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/scsi/mpt3sas/mpt3sas_scsih.c b/drivers/scsi/mpt3sas/mpt3sas_scsih.c
index b819914..3f640ba 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/mpt3sas/mpt3sas_scsih.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/mpt3sas/mpt3sas_scsih.c
@@ -8808,6 +8808,7 @@ _scsih_determine_hba_mpi_version(struct pci_dev *pdev)
 	case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3516:
 	case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3516_1:
 	case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3416:
+	case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3616:
 		return MPI26_VERSION;
 	}
 	return 0;
@@ -8885,6 +8886,7 @@ _scsih_probe(struct pci_dev *pdev, const struct pci_device_id *id)
 		case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3516:
 		case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3516_1:
 		case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3416:
+		case M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3616:
 			ioc->is_gen35_ioc = 1;
 			break;
 		default:
@@ -9341,6 +9343,9 @@ static const struct pci_device_id mpt3sas_pci_table[] = {
 		PCI_ANY_ID, PCI_ANY_ID },
 	{ MPI2_MFGPAGE_VENDORID_LSI, M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3416,
 		PCI_ANY_ID, PCI_ANY_ID },
+	/* Mercator ~ 3616*/
+	{ MPI2_MFGPAGE_VENDORID_LSI, MPI26_MFGPAGE_DEVID_SAS3616,
+		PCI_ANY_ID, PCI_ANY_ID },
 	{0}     /* Terminating entry */
 };
 M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(pci, mpt3sas_pci_table);
